Welcome to Jackson ...

The village of Jackson is located in Dakota County<1>.


The location of Jackson has been provided by the Geographic Names Information System (ie- the GNIS).<2>


While we don't have a date for the founding of Jackson, you might get a feel for it by knowing that during our research the earliest mention that we found (so far) was on a map dated 1895.

When the people of Jackson refer to themselves (known as a demonym), they frequently use Jacksonian<3>

From the  Census Estimates for 2019, Jackson has a population of 202 people<4> (see below for details).

Jackson is 1,120 feet [341 m] above sea level.<5>.

Time Zone: Jackson lies in the Central Time Zone (CST/CDT) and observes daylight saving time

Area codes for Jackson: (402) & (531)<6>

Population Details ...

Taken from the 2019 Census Estimates, Jackson had an population of 202 people. This is a decrease of 9.42% since the 2010 Census (or a decrease of 1.46% since the 2000 Census).

At the time of the 2010 Census, Jackson had a population of 223 people. This makes Jackson the county's 6th most populous community.

The population of Jackson represents 0.01% of the total population of Nebraska (which has 1,826,341 people), making it the state's 324th most populous community.

With a 2010 count of 223 people, the population of Jackson increased 8.78% from the 2000 Census (with a count of 205 people).
